Ares Capital reported strong Q4 2021 financial results, with increased core earnings and net asset value, and declared a first quarter dividend of $0.42 per share and additional dividends totaling $0.12 per share for 2022.
Ares Capital Corporation announced its financial results for the fourth quarter and year ended December 31, 2021, featuring record results across originations, core earnings, and net asset value. The company increased its regular quarterly dividend to $0.42 per share and declared additional dividends totaling $0.12 per share for 2022.
- Ares Capital declared a first quarter dividend of $0.42 per share and additional dividends totaling $0.12 per share for 2022.
- Core EPS for Q4 2021 was $0.58 per share, compared to $0.54 per share in Q4 2020.
- GAAP net income for Q4 2021 was $382 million, or $0.83 per share, compared to $378 million, or $0.89 per share in Q4 2020.
- The company made new investment commitments of approximately $5.9 billion in Q4 2021.
